Casual and Historic Street Style
It’s easy to work the Edi Gathegi Bootleg Vintage Shirt into your daily wardrobe. Pair it with ripped denim and classic sneakers for a timeless, street-ready look.
Layering it over a long-sleeve tee can add textural depth, perfect for transitional weather. For a more relaxed feel, combine it with joggers for a comfortable yet stylish aesthetic.

Bootleg vs. Authentic: A Matter of Intent
A common misunderstanding is that bootleg means counterfeit. In reality, the Edi Gathegi Bootleg Vintage Shirt is a reinterpretation. Authentic vintage pieces carry the physical history of their time, often with visible wear.
Bootleg shirts, however, offer a new perspective on old styles, often with updated cuts while maintaining a vintage soul. The choice between the two comes down to personal taste and what you want your fashion to say.
